Output 31a6dc9fe44d215f5acebae0d9ac965b7086f3d83e639c2bb60c1c24e3d0b91c:0

value
1079539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66eb01ddb74f9460aaf9465e0edce1f180e4d49f OP_EQUAL
address
3B5CNhjknb61ZKQHqYxnFbPWmRGAP2AE2G
transaction
31a6dc9fe44d215f5acebae0d9ac965b7086f3d83e639c2bb60c1c24e3d0b91c
spent
true